DIRECTOR, FINANCE - Bilingual English and French

JOB OVERVIEW

Reporting to the Vice-President, Corporate Services and Chief Financial Officer, the Director, Finance is accountable for planning, developing, and implementing policies, procedures, and systems to ensure the effective and efficient delivery of comprehensive financial services. You will provide expert advice on all financial matters and oversee the delivery of key services, including financial planning, budgeting, financial reporting and analysis, and payments in lieu of taxes.

QUALIFICATIONS and EDUCATION

A degree from a recognized university with a specialization in Finance, Accounting, or a discipline related to the position.

EXPERIENCE

A minimum of eight (8) years of experience in holding progressively significant responsibilities in management-related fields and experience in each of the following :

  • Overseeing the application of appropriate accounting standards and effective financial management.
  • Ensuring compliance with government acts, statutes, and regulations, as well as central agency policies, while supporting due diligence and stewardship of public resources through the application of appropriate internal controls.
  • Aligning business objectives with operational management of people, policies, systems, and practices for financial planning, operations, accounting, financial statements preparation, and reporting purposes.

CERTIFICATION / LICENSE

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A) designation.

KNOWLEDGE

  • Financial policies, practices, and priorities related to financial management, operational planning, procurement, and asset management.
  • Finance business transformation and change management initiatives, including methodologies, designing and implementing change strategies, and measuring the impact.
  • Experience in procurement.
  • Experience analyzing and applying accounting standards.
  • Knowledge of the management of payments in lieu of taxes.

ABILITIES

  • To establish sound business partnerships, network, and interact effectively with internal and external stakeholders, including auditors.
  • To justify the organization’s financial statements, reports, and submissions.
  • To provide guidance and strategic advice to senior management.
  • To identify and act on opportunities to improve business efficiency and performance.
  • To negotiate, build consensus, and resolve complex issues.
  • To lead and mentor multidisciplinary teams to provide high-level quality client services.

KEY LEADERSHIP COMPETENCIES

  • Create Vision and Strategy.
  • Uphold Integrity and Respect.
  • Collaborate with Partners and Stakeholders.
  • Promote Innovation and Guide Change.

CONDITIONS OF EMPLOYMENT

  • Possess or be eligible to obtain secret security clearance.
  • Position is in the National Capital Region. The person selected for this position must reside within a commutable distance from the workplace at Elgin Street, Ottawa, Ontario.
  • The National Capital Commission offers a hybrid and flexible work environment.
  • The successful candidate may be required to work irregular hours and overtime (evenings, weekends, and public holidays) on occasion.
  • Candidates must be eligible to work in Canada.
